I have a 97 f-350 with 7.3 power stroke 4x4, it has a E4OD trans.
It shifts ok most of the time but when cruising at 55 mph the engine runs at 2200 rpm, sometimes it shifts fine and it runs at 1800 rpm at 55. Sometimes seems to double shift at the third step. I can toggele it in and out of overdrive with push button and trans. shifts down and up like it should, increasing the engine rpms by about 600 to 700 rpm.
Has anyone seen this problem, or offer any insight to what the trouble may be.
I'm wondering, like Falcon, if your TC is slipping. Doing the TC switch mod would tell you if its slipping. Its a easy mod of spliceing into one wire back at the trans and putting a toggle switch in the cab. You could lock your TC to see if its in 4th gear or slipping in 3rd gear.
